Noah * * * 1/2


From the perspective of movie story telling, Noah entertains very well with plot, action, special effects, creatures and magic that all seem more at home in a movie like "The Hobbit" than they do in the retelling of a biblical story.  The movie adds its own Hollywood spin that seems to have a lot of Greenpeace influence and a little bit Darwinian, while also remaining somewhat respectful to the biblical stories.  The fact that they embellished and changed the story so much might turn off some of the faithful, but the movie is both entertaining and emotionally moving.   And this is despite the mishmash of many different elements that don't quite match what you learned in Sunday School.  This is a new spin on an old story and it works.
